Photo of Juniperus Depressa Aurea (Juniper conifer)
Juniperus communis Depressa Aurea - Conifer, evergreen, dwarf shrub, rarely above 4 ft (1.2 m) high, essentially procumbent. Leaves awl-shaped, to 15 mm long, with a glaucous white band on upper surface with a green margin. New shoots strongly colored yellow, fades with time; can brown in winter.
